Cohen, S. Alan – Wilson Library Bulletin, 1976
Somehow we must convince "reading experts" that reading books--really curling up and silently digging through a real book--on school time is the newest and best teaching machine, kit, or workbook invented to teach children to read. We need librarians' help. (Author)

McCutcheon, Randall – Wilson Library Bulletin, 1990
Describes a "scavenger hunt" approach to teaching research and critical thinking skills to high school and college students. Students are provided with lists of challenging questions, supporting materials (cartoons, quotations, odd facts and humorous excerpts), and clues for developing a research strategy. York, Maurice C. – Wilson Library Bulletin, 1992
Argues that local history collections in the public library can be used by teachers to make their lessons challenging and more meaningful and outlines factors a public librarian needs to consider in developing cooperative teaching programs with schools using primary documents.
